This story is about the Russian invasion of Afghanistan. It's about the KGB and CIA, plenty of spies and counter-intelligence. Which makes it all a bit dated, but still entertaining.

To me, the most interesting plot line revolved around former-CIA agent Alexander Fannin and his wife's cousin Tolya who works for the KGB. Their family and political loyalties interweave as Alexander helps Tolya's mother to defect.

The author worked for the CIA and this has helped him write a fast-paced book that never streteches credibility beyond reasonable limits.… (more)

It's a bit daunting at first trying to remember all the Russian names, never mind all the American names and secret spy code names, and to keep track of all the connections. But once you get used to the rhythm of the book it is a thrilling series of episodes in the recent history of KGB and CIA espionage. I keep thinking about where I was and what I was doing, while all these secret events were taking place far away, since the exact dates and times are provided. An inside look at the last days of the Soviet Union and beyond.… (more)

Beardon was a high level operator in anti-soviet CIA operations 1985-6. This detailed account is based in part on interviews with his opposite numbers in the KGB in preperation for this book. Then he was in charge of CIA covert operations in Afghanistan. James Risen is a lead reporter at the New York Times reporting on military affairs. I assume he kept Beardon honest.
